On March 23, the Bureau of Ecology and Environment of Puer City, Yunnan Province, issued a reply on the environmental impact report form of Banpozhai Photovoltaic Power Generation Project.

On March 23, the Bureau of Ecology and Environment of Puer City, Yunnan Province, issued a reply on the environmental impact report form of Banpozhai Photovoltaic Power Generation Project.

According to the announcement, the project is located in Banpo Village, Yixiang Town, Simao District, Puer City, Yunnan Province. The nature of construction is new construction, and the total area of the project is 1047174.8.

The project construction unit is Huaneng East China (Pu'er Tea) Clean Energy Co., Ltd. with a total investment of 280 million yuan and an AC side capacity of 65 MW. A total of 615 WpN-type monocrystalline silicon double-sided double-glass photovoltaic modules with 129948 blocks are installed, and the whole photovoltaic power station is divided into 19 sub-arrays.

17 sub-arrays are 3.6MW, and each sub-array includes 12 inverters and 1 3600kVA box transformer; one sub-array is 2.0MW, including 7 inverters and 1 2000kVA box transformer; One sub-array is 1.8 MW, including six inverters and one 1800 kVA box transformer. The construction period of the

project is 8 months .
